According to Harian Metro, a store assistant was caught spying a man who was… well, pooping at a gas station.

Man In Toilet Cubicle
Source: Sick Chirpse

It is understood that the poor victim was defecating in the toilet as he had a tummy ache. While in the process of defecation, he suddenly noticed something moving being reflected in a puddle of water on the floor. He then saw a reflection of a man outside the door with his pants off relieving himself.

From that, the victim finally noticed a hole the size of his pinky finger and a man spying through it. The one thing that was really unbelievable was when the defecating man asked whether the pervert was spying on him, and he actually replied yes!

The pervert was then caught and Magistrate Nurshahira Abdul Salim sentenced him a fine of RM100 under Section 14 of Minor Offences Act 1955.

The suspect, who was not represented by a lawyer, requested that the court lighten his sentence.  However, his pleas were denied by Deputy Public Prosecutor Hairuliqram Hairuddin, who requested for a full charge as a lesson for him.
